Festivals are lively events filled with music, food, and excitement, but they also pose significant fire safety risks if you’re not careful. When attending a festival, understanding and respecting fire safety regulations is vital. These regulations are put in place by local authorities to prevent fires and protect everyone. They often specify where you can and can’t set up grills, how close tents or stages can be to electrical sources, and the maximum capacity for certain areas. Ignoring these rules increases the risk of fires breaking out, which can quickly escalate into dangerous situations. As a festival-goer, you should stay informed about these regulations and follow them diligently. This helps guarantee not only your safety but also the safety of others around you.

Emergency preparedness planning is equally essential when you’re at a festival. Before attending, familiarize yourself with the location of emergency exits, first aid stations, and fire extinguishers. Knowing how to quickly find safety in case of an emergency can make all the difference. Keep an eye out for posted signs and listen to announcements about safety procedures. Carry a small flashlight or mobile light source in case the power goes out or visibility becomes limited. If you notice something suspicious, such as an unattended bag near a cooking area or sparks coming from electrical equipment, report it immediately to festival staff. Quick action can prevent a small issue from becoming a full-blown fire. Additionally, understanding and adhering to fire safety regulations can significantly reduce the likelihood of incidents occurring.

It’s also wise to prepare an emergency plan with your friends or family members attending with you. Decide on a meeting spot outside the festival grounds in case you get separated, and agree on a way to communicate if mobile networks become congested. Keep your phone charged and consider carrying a portable charger. Remember that alcohol can impair your judgment and reaction time, so stay alert and avoid risky behaviors around open flames or electrical setups. If a fire occurs, stay calm and follow the instructions of festival staff and emergency responders. Use designated exits to leave the area, and do so swiftly but safely.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Can Festival Attendees Identify Fire Hazards in Crowded Areas?

To spot fire hazards in crowded areas, stay alert and practice fire hazard spotting by looking for obvious signs like open flames, faulty wiring, or clutter blocking exits. Maintain crowd awareness by observing your surroundings and identifying potential risks, such as overloaded power strips or flammable materials. Keep an eye out for emergency exits and fire extinguishers, and report any hazards to event staff immediately to help keep everyone safe.

What Are the Best Practices for Evacuating Large Crowds During a Fire?

You should implement clear crowd management strategies, like designated evacuation routes and trained staff to guide attendees quickly. Use effective emergency communication, such as loudspeakers and visual signals, to inform everyone calmly and promptly. Ensuring these practices are in place helps prevent panic, directs people safely out of danger, and minimizes injuries during a fire. Regular drills and coordination with emergency services also boost your evacuation efficiency.
